As one of the world’s premier biotechnology companies, our mission is centered on delivering life-changing products that advance world health and help fight and cure disease. As a Senior Scientist in the Early Vaccines and Immune Therapies Unit (Early V&I) in Seattle, WA, you’ll play a pivotal role in channeling our scientific capabilities to make a positive impact on changing patients’ lives.  

 

The Early V&I team at AstraZeneca is discovering and developing novel vaccines and biologics targeting key viral pathogens We are consistently pushing the boundaries of science to deliver life-changing medicines to patients Our deep expertise in virology, bacteriology, immunology, and vaccines enables our ability to advance novel therapeutic approaches and technologies to prevent and treat infectious disease We have an industry-leading pipeline and offer a unique and strong collaborative network as part of the AstraZeneca family. 

 

Currently, we are seeking a highly motivated and broadly skilled scientist with scientific and technical expertise in machine learning based computational protein design and structural biology demonstrating a track record of scientific achievement to join the group at AstraZeneca in Seattle, WA The Senior Scientist will be a key member of a growing, dynamic team focused on developing next-generation vaccines and antibody therapeutics through the implementation of protein design in the drug discovery process The position requires a strong interest in computational protein design work driving projects forward AstraZeneca has a dynamic environment that fosters collaboration and innovation as we look to attract and develop top talent. 

 

Major responsibilities: 

  • Perform a range of computational experiments to design and generate novel protein antigens, immunogens, binders, and antibodies that elicit prophylactic immunity or provide therapeutic benefit against clinically relevant pathogens 

  • Develop, validate, and maintain novel computational pipelines based on various protein structure software (e.g., deep learning, generative models, structure prediction, docking, and molecular simulation) for protein antigen, binder and antibody design 

  • Contribute to new concepts and methodologies in antigen design, protein nanoparticle scaffolding, multivalent display, epitope focusing, and other emerging vaccine technology modalities
